  5. Shenzhen Metro -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Shenzhen_Metro

    The Shenzhen Metro (深圳地铁) is the rapid transit system for the city of Shenzhen in Guangdong province, China.The newest lines and extensions which opened on December 27, 2024 put the network at 595.1 kilometres (369.8 miles) [5] [b] of trackage.
